实现Java中文站几个字符的方法

1. 整体流程

为了实现在Java中统计中文字符串的字符数,我们可以采取以下步骤:

步骤 操作
1 将输入的字符串转换为字符数组
2 遍历字符数组,判断每个字符是否是中文字符
3 统计中文字符的数量

2. 代码示例

步骤1:将输入的字符串转换为字符数组

String input = "Java中文站";
char[] charArray = input.toCharArray(); // 将字符串转换为字符数组

步骤2:遍历字符数组,判断每个字符是否是中文字符

int chineseCount = 0;
for (char c : charArray) {
    if (isChineseChar(c)) {
        chineseCount++;
    }
}

// 判断是否为中文字符的方法
public boolean isChineseChar(char c) {
    return String.valueOf(c).matches("[\u4e00-\u9fa5]"); // 使用正则表达式判断是否为中文字符
}

步骤3:统计中文字符的数量

System.out.println("中文字符的数量为:" + chineseCount);

类图

classDiagram
    class String {
        toCharArray()
    }
    class Character {
        isChineseChar()
    }
    class System {
        out
    }

结尾

通过以上代码示例和类图,你应该已经了解了在Java中如何统计中文字符的数量了。希望这篇文章对你有所帮助,如果有任何问题,请随时向我提问。祝你编程愉快!